Kevin Hoff (PhD, University of Illinois) is an Assistant Professor of Organizational Psychology. Kevin's research focuses on individual differences and career and life outcomes. In particular, he studies the use of psychological assessments (personality, interests, values, and skills) for decision-making purposes, including career planning and human resource management.
